How popular is Jaila right now?
Falling — down 556 spots — currently #4796 in the US out of 135.5k tracked names
| Year | US Rank | Births | vs Prior Year |
|---|
| 2023 | #4796 | 28 | ▼ down 556 · -18% births |
| 2022 | #4240 | 34 | ▲ up 524 · +21% births |
| 2021 | #4764 | 28 | ▼ down 1839 · -49% births |
| 2020 | #2925 | 55 | ▲ up 121 · -2% births |
| 2015 | #3046 | 56 | ▼ down 1264 · -52% births |
| 2010 | #1782 | 116 | ▼ down 422 · -28% births |
| 2005 | #1360 | 160 | ▲ up 312 · +51% births |
| 2000 | #1672 | 106 | ▲ up 2102 · +266% births |
| 1995 | #3774 | 29 | — |
The story of Jaila
Jaila is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 1988. With 2,484 total births recorded, Jaila remains relatively uncommon. Once ranked #3774 in 1995, the name has become less common in recent years, sitting at #4796 in 2023.

Jaila by decade
Jaila peaked in the 2000s. See all 2000s names →
| Decade | Births | |
|---|
| 1980s | 5 | |
| 1990s | 271 | |
| 2000s ★ | 1,442 | |
| 2010s | 711 | |
| 2020s | 55 | |
